IBM Hybrid Cloud Mesh provides enterprises with a secure, automated, and seamless way to connect applications across multiple clouds and clusters without requiring manual network reconfigurations.
IBM Hybrid Cloud Mesh is a SaaS-based, multi-cloud, multi-cluster networking solution that intelligently infers network requirements based on business intent. Application-Centric Virtual Application Networks (VANs): IBM Hybrid Cloud Mesh enables developers to create Virtual Application Networks (VANs)—a software-defined, application-level network that abstracts infrastructure complexities. This means applications remain even if they migrate across cloud environments.
Layer-7 Networking for Automated Connectivity: Unlike traditional network models that operate at Layer-3 (IP-based networking), IBM Hybrid Cloud Mesh operates at Layer-7, enabling applications to communicate without relying on fixed IP addresses. This ensures seamless application mobility and security.
Built-in Security and Zero Trust Architecture: IBM Hybrid Cloud Mesh enforces zero-trust security for distributed applications. Every microservice connection is authenticated and encrypted, reducing the risk of lateral movement for security threats.
